The borax method is a technique of artisanal gold mining, which uses borax as a flux to purify gold concentrates. By using borax, no mercury flour is produced, hence gold recovery increases . The borax method of gold extraction has been used by artisanal gold miners in .
Alternatives of Mercury and Best Available Techniques (BATs) and Best Environmental Practices (BEPs) in Artisanal and Small Scale Mining in Tanzania" which based on awareness raising on alternative technologies on recovering gold in central and lake zone due to the fact that similar project
The borax method of gold extraction has been used by artisanal gold miners in the Benguet area north of Manila in the Philippines for more than 30 years. Some believe it was in practice as early as the 1900s. [who?] The method is increasingly being seen as a safe alternative to the widespread use of toxic mercury in artisanal gold mining today. Aug 07, 2013· With some borax, heat, and a little knowhow, it's possible to extract pure gold from a sample of ore. This is because using borax as the flux reduces the melting point of all the elements in a piece of ore, including gold. While out in the field, a gold prospector can grind and wash a piece of ore, then mix it with borax in a plastic bag.

Abstract. Borax is used as a safer alternative to elemental mercury for extracting gold in artisanal and smallscale gold mining (ASGM). Borax is not acutely toxic, although exposure to borax dusts/powders is associated with eye, throat, nose, and skin irritation. Borax is not thought to cause cancer.
